noun a temporary passageway of planks (as over mud on a building site)
noun a temporary bridge for getting on and off a vessel at dockside
noun passageway between seating areas as in an auditorium or passenger vehicle or between areas of shelves of goods as in stores
originFrom Middle English gangway, from Old English gangweġ (“passageway; thoroughfare”), equivalent to gang + way. Related to Dutch gang (“hallway”) and Norwegian gang (“hallway”).
